Virgin Atlantic celebrated their return to the South African skies by bringing some of the top 80s acts for a Rewind the 80s music festival. See Rick Astley, Nik Kershaw, Leee John (Imagination) and Tony Hadley (Spandau Ballet) meet the press in Cape Town. (Photos: Claudia Dijkkamp, Channel24)
